WORKFLOW EXAMPLE
An illustrative workflow for a configurable industrial controller, with recorded configuration, I/O checks, and a team review of exceptions.
Controller → fixture → response
Record the cabinet serial, controller revision, firmware identifier, and installed I/O modules.
Capture input and output checks, communications results, and the measurements from the test fixture.
Keep the functional result and supporting files with the cabinet’s earlier module tests.
Send the affected runs to the test team. Compare fixture connections and controller variants, then choose a reference check or a targeted product retest.
